Reliable flow measurement supports raw-water intake, treatment, chemical dosing, distribution and wastewater discharge. Electromagnetic flow meters are well suited to conductive liquids, while clamp-on ultrasonic meters provide a non-intrusive option for existing pipelines.
Instrument selection should consider conductivity, solids content, pipe material, lining and electrode compatibility, installation space, enclosure rating and the required communication interface.
